Maria Oglinzanu
Maria Oglinzanu is a student and a deputy editor-in-chief at the student magazine Alecart in Iași, Romania. She gained attention for her review of the film 'Cravata Galbenă', which was controversially targeted for censorship by the film's production team, highlighting the tensions between emerging voices in criticism and established film authorities.
